What to Wear to Work (Part 2)



Last week, we took a close look at 7 attributes in Colossians 3:12 which as Christian women at work, we should be “wearing” in the workplace.


This week, we examine the remaining 3 to round out the series, based upon the two following verses.


“Be even-tempered, content with second place, quick to forgive an offense. Forgive as quickly and completely as the Master forgave you. And regardless of what else you put on, wear love. It’s your basic, all-purpose garment. Never be without it.” (Colossians 3:13-14 MSG)

Top 10 List of Attributes to Wear at Work


8. EVEN TEMPERED: Being able to keep one’s cool under duress and keep your temper in check at work is a very desirable quality to have on display at work, which reminds me of putting on the correct “top” at work in every season and situation.


9. CONTENT WITH SECOND PLACE - similar to HUMILITY, both are rooted in not seeking popularity or position, but instead serve others without a secret agenda. As this is also an attitude which is walked out, a pair of “pants” would remind us as we pull them on one leg at a time to wear this attribute in our work place.


10. QUICK TO FORGIVE - Just as Jesus forgives us, we are to offer forgiveness quickly and 100% completely to those around us at work. Regardless of who has done what, just as Jesus does. To me, this represents our “purse” - that we would be quick to open it when we have need of what is inside, namely grace & mercy in the shape of forgiveness.


And this verse closes with a specific reminder of #2 of last week’s attributes, the most important one:

LOVE - As mentioned last week, we each get a fresh new start when we become God’s children, the foundation of which is love. This love is to visibly “coat” us wherever we are. Colossians 3:14 reminds us that love is our basic, all purpose garment which we are never to be without. Just as God is love, we are meant to display and express love wherever we are, especially when in the workplace.
